WebSep 22, 2024 · As you remove the loose paint from your home by sanding and scraping, you'll likely notice individual areas that have become damaged. The damage might be from weather wear and tear, or possibly from animal or insect activity. Regardless of the cause, this is the perfect time to make repairs.

WebFeb 17, 2024 · Then—using a putty knife, wire brush, or paint scraper—carefully remove all the chipped or peeling paint from the walls and ceiling. STEP 2: Prep the surface. Using a putty knife, apply... WebRemove all the paint off the wall, using a scraper, or a heat torch, or a paint remover. Sand paper all the wall. Remove all the dust from the wall and wipe it clean. Do many layers of sealer or primer. Let it dry for 24 hours. Do many layers of good quality paint.

Scrape Loose Paint With the Blunt Tool Begin with the blunt tool. Put the scraper end … WebFind a paint scraper, wire brush, sandpaper and a primer. Spackle, paint and a paint applicator are used later in the process. Lay out drop cloths or a tarp to protect your floor. Remove furniture from the area or cover it. Use painter’s tape around trim or baseboards. It helps protect them from paint drips and spatters.
